Updates on NIST’s Interagency International Cybersecurity Standardization Working Group

Last November, I was pleased to chair the most recent meeting of the Interagency International Cybersecurity Standardization Working Group (IICSWG) – a group NIST created in 2016. Our charge, from the Cybersecurity Enhancement Act of 2014, was to build a coordination mechanism for government agencies to discuss international cybersecurity standardization issues, consistent with agencies’ responsibilities under OMB Circular A-119. Since then, IICSWG has grown as a forum to discuss cybersecurity and privacy standardization topics, examine the overall cybersecurity standardization landscape (NISTIR 8074 Vol. 1 – Interagency Report on Strategic U.S. Government Engagement in International Standardization to Achieve U.S. Objectives for Cybersecurity), and provide a deep dive into IoT cybersecurity standards (NISTIR 8200 – Interagency Report on the Status of International Cybersecurity Standardization for the Internet of Things (IoT)).

A lot has changed since IICSWG was first created. Within NIST, our cybersecurity and privacy experts have been busy developing new and updated guidance across the cybersecurity domain – from frameworks like the NIST Cybersecurity Framework 2.0 and Privacy Framework 1.1 to guidance on zero trust and secure IoT implementations – and integrating that guidance into international standards. The National Cybersecurity Strategy Implementation Plan called upon NIST to reconvene with IICSWG to assist the United States Government (USG) in making progress on cybersecurity standardization. In addition, the White House’s United States Government National Standards Strategy for Critical and Emerging Technology (CET) highlights the importance of cybersecurity and privacy standardization and the critical role that the USG plays.

Today, IICSWG has cybersecurity and privacy representatives from more than 16 departments and agencies lending their expertise. The group met most recently in November 2023 and will hit the ground running in CY2024, now with a refreshed charter and updated focus areas.
